Severe Wind — TX

3h agoAmarilloUnited StatesSource: spc

Wind 80 kt near 3 NE Pantex, Carson, TX. Report of 80.5 mph wind gust at 10 meters from the DOE Net Tower 2 miles north of Pantex. (AMA)
